Output 75606bb2f3db3b9071df1de2fccd2d8796dde0d0b3d19a08a526467bb333ca09:26

value
181938
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05a6e94f09897a89f6bf3104761a61cdd9fdaaca OP_EQUAL
address
32CuFhzrHnDQmrbDztM1SHSjfQhnkPKK3o
transaction
75606bb2f3db3b9071df1de2fccd2d8796dde0d0b3d19a08a526467bb333ca09
spent
true